Read the following article and choose the best word for each space.
For questions 26-45, mark one letter A, B, C or D on your Answer Sheet.
Long-Term Care Crisis
The apparent demise of the Class Act leaves many middle-income Americans【C1】______to cope with rising expenses【C2】______long-term care for family members, The Times reported on Tuesday.
Unlike the rich, who can afford to pay for services themselves, or the poor, who get help【C3】______Medicaid, the federal and state program for low-income people, many members of the middle class have to look【C4】______disabled relatives themselves, or pay someone to do it. Polls show that many people believe that Medicare, the federal health program for those 65【C5】______older, pays for such care.【C6】______, Medicare stops paying nursing【C7】______bills after 100 days.
More than 10 million people in the United States already have long-term care【C8】______, and two-thirds of the costs are paid for by government programs,【C9】______Medicaid. Studies estimate that unpaid family members deliver an even【C10】______share of the care, and the cost of nursing home care averages $72,000,a year.
The Class Act’s ambitions were undercut by an impractical structure that doomed it from the【C11】______experts and government actuaries say. Its【C12】______harks back to an attempt by President Ronald Reagan and a Democratic Congress to protect the elderly from catastrophic medical expenses and provide a modest prescription drug benefit and somewhat【C13】______nursing home care.
That law, the Medicare Catastrophic Coverage Act of 1988, was repealed within months of enactment after a furious response by elderly voters angry that they had to【C14】______for the benefits themselves through a tax mostly paid【C15】______the wealthy. In a famous【C16】______, Representative Dan Rostenkowski, an Illinois Democrat who was chairman of the powerful House Ways and Means Committee, was booed and chased【C17】______a Chicago street by a group of elderly people, one of【C18】______draped herself over the hood of his car.
The repeal legislation created a commission to examine the issue of long-term care, but it【C19】______the appetite of many in Congress to resolve the issue. The Clinton health plan made another attempt at improving long-term care, but the bill failed. And now the demise of the Class Act is【C20】______history.
